Rudolf von Seelhorst (General, 1700)

from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Just Rudolf Seelhorst , von Seelhorst since 1744 (* December 7, 1700 in Kirchboitzen ; † January 6, 1779 in Aschersleben ) was a Prussian major general , chief of the cuirassier regiment "von Vasold" , as well as a knight of the order Pour le Mérite and governor of Jerichow.

origin

His father was the pastor in Kirchboitzen Lewin Seelhorst (1656-1721), his mother Margarethe Sophie Bodecker (1668-1722) from Hanover.

Military career

In 1716, Seelhorst joined the “von der Schulenburg” dragoon regiment as a common soldier and was promoted to quartermaster and sergeant until 1725. In 1726 he was promoted to ensign and in 1731 advanced to lieutenant and adjutant . In 1742 he was given command of the body squadron from Margrave Friedrich von Bayreuth , and he largely left the regiment to him. In 1742 he was made chief of staff and in 1756 chief of a squadron and major. In 1760 he became a lieutenant colonel and regimental commander. On September 1, 1764 he was promoted to colonel , in 1769 he was appointed major general and chief of the cuirassier regiment "von Vasold". In 1766 he was appointed governor of Jerichow .

He was involved in numerous battles. Seelhorst fought in the Battle of Mollwitz in 1740 and in Chotusitz in 1742 , where he was shot in the neck. He was at Hohenfriedberg , Kesselsdorf , Lobositz , Breslau , Leuthen and Torgau . He was also present at both sieges of Prague and the siege of Olomouc.

He was able to stand out personally after the Battle of Hohenfriedeberg in the battle near Neustadt on July 31, 1745. With his unit he was able to drive out an entire corps of cavalry and Croats. For this he received a gift of 500 thalers from the king. In the battle of Torgau his squadron was the first to encounter the infantry.

For his bravery he was elevated to the Prussian nobility on March 16, 1744 by King Friedrich II .

family

Seelhorst married Beate Charlotte von Böckern (1729–1753) on June 4, 1744, with whom he had the following children:

  • Maria Charlotte (1746–1832) ⚭ 1767 Henning Friedrich von Seelhorst († 1814), head of the grand ducal oldenburg court in Plön , parents of Just Friedrich von Seelhorst
  • Sophie Elisabeth Justine (* / † 1747)
  • Friedrich Moritz Otto (* / † 1748)
  • Just Friedrich Wilhelm (1749–1751)
  • Karoline Fredrike (1750–1807)
⚭ 1767 (divorce) Heinrich Graf von Dyherrn , Major, Herr auf Nistitz
⚭ 1773 Jean Claude de Pennavaire, Rittmeister
  • Sophie Ulrike Franziska Justine (1752–1828) ⚭ 1772 Friedrich Johann von Borcke († 1777), Prussian major
  • Moritz Rudolf (1753–1815), Colonel a. D. ⚭ 1784 Juliane Charlotte Luise Karoline von Raven (1770–1830)

After the death of his first wife, Seelhorst married Florentine Dorothea von der Dollen (1719–1791) from the Klein-Luckow family on September 4, 1754 . She outlived her husband and received a royal pension. The couple had several children:

  • Just Friedrich Karl (1755–1812) ⚭ 1791 Karoline Henriette von Holleufer (1774–1833), parents of Ferdinand von Seelhorst
  • Karl Rudolf Ernst (1756–1757)
  • Luise Dorothea Ernestine (1759-1819)
⚭ Christian Friedrich von Weyrach († 1802), Prussian major, master of Röversdorf
⚭ NN von Kalckreuth, Prussian major
